Heim > Web-Frontend > js-Tutorial > Hauptteil

Ist Javascript eine ereignisgesteuerte Sprache?

醉折花枝作酒筹
Freigeben: 2023-01-07 11:43:32
Original
3674 Leute haben es durchsucht

JavaScript ist eine objekt- und ereignisgesteuerte Skriptsprache mit Sicherheitsfunktionen. Grundfunktionen: objektbasierte Sprache, Einfachheit, Sicherheit, Dynamik, plattformübergreifend, eine Skriptsprache und eine interpretierte Sprache.

Ist Javascript eine ereignisgesteuerte Sprache?

Die Betriebsumgebung dieses Tutorials: Windows 7-System, JavaScript-Version 1.8.5, Dell G3-Computer.

JavaScript ist eine objekt- und ereignisgesteuerte Skriptsprache mit Sicherheitsfunktionen.

Grundlegende Funktionen: objektbasierte Sprache, Einfachheit, Sicherheit, Dynamik, plattformübergreifend, eine Skriptsprache, Interpretationstypsprache (ohne Kompilierung, direkt interpretiert und vom Browser ausgeführt)

Verwenden Sie den Operator „typeof“, um zu beurteilen

NaN – keine Zahl, d. h. ein nicht numerischer Wert a. NaN wird verwendet, um anzugeben, dass ein Operand ursprünglich einen numerischen Wert zurückgeben sollte hat keinen Wert zurückgegeben. b. Jede Operation, an der NaN beteiligt ist, ist nicht gleich einem Wert, einschließlich NaN selbst, und gibt „false“ zurück

 Wenn es sich um einen numerischen Wert handelt, wird er selbst zurückgegeben. Wenn er null ist, wird 0 zurückgegeben. Wenn er undefiniert ist, wird NaN zurückgegeben. Wenn es sich um eine Zeichenfolge handelt, befolgen Sie die folgenden Regeln:

  –Wenn die Zeichenfolge nur Zahlen enthält, konvertieren Sie in eine Dezimalzahl umwandeln (ignorieren Sie die führende 0)

  – Wenn die Zeichenfolge ein gültiges Gleitkommaformat enthält, konvertieren Sie sie in einen Gleitkommawert (ignorieren Sie die führende 0) – – Wenn es sich um eine leere Zeichenfolge handelt, konvertieren Sie sie in 0

- – Wenn die Zeichenfolge ein anderes als das oben genannte Format enthält, konvertieren Sie sie in NaN

Wenn es sich um ein Objekt handelt, rufen Sie die valueOf-Methode des Objekts auf und konvertieren Sie dann den zurückgegebenen Wert gemäß den vorherigen Regeln. Wenn das Ergebnis der Konvertierung NaN ist, rufen Sie die toString-Methode des Objekts auf und konvertieren Sie den zurückgegebenen String-Wert erneut gemäß den vorherigen Regeln.

  parseInt – Konvertieren Sie eine Zeichenfolge in einen ganzzahligen Wert. Die Regeln lauten wie folgt: Ignorieren Sie die Leerzeichen vor der Zeichenfolge, bis das erste nicht leere Zeichen gefunden wird , geben Sie NaN zurück. Wenn das erste Zeichen kein numerisches Symbol oder ein negatives Vorzeichen ist, wird NaN zurückgegeben, bis die Zeichenfolge analysiert wird oder ein nicht numerisches Symbol gefunden wird Das vorherige Parsen beginnt mit 0 und wird als Oktalwert analysiert. Wenn es mit 0x beginnt, wird es als Hexadezimalwert analysiert.

【Empfohlenes Lernen:

Javascript-Tutorial für Fortgeschrittene

Das obige ist der detaillierte Inhalt vonIst Javascript eine ereignisgesteuerte Sprache?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age